Output 029e1b53ab1c4039b73756526158f4e655313a425a52f5b3d16421ae09b88548:5

value
170685884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53c5dd328ed229c9f4fabbaee9877cc95b1d2520 OP_EQUAL
address
39Ky3JR5DyhHUC6fMsp6GMT59rGzm5LnWS
transaction
029e1b53ab1c4039b73756526158f4e655313a425a52f5b3d16421ae09b88548
spent
true